Unpack the switch
NOTE: Before unpacking the switch, inspect the container and immediately report any evidence of damage.
When unpacking the S4048-ON switch, ensure that the following items are included:
● One S4048-ON switch
● One RJ45 to DB-9 female cable
● Two sets of rail kits, no tools required
● One PSU—a second PSU is sold separately.
● One AC country or region-specific power cable
● S4048–ON Getting Started Guide
● Safety and Regulatory Information
● Warranty and Support Information
Unpack
1. Place the container on a clean, flat surface and cut all straps securing the container.
2. Open the container or remove the container top.
3. Carefully remove the switch from the container and place it on a secure and clean surface.
4. Remove all packing material.
5. Inspect the product and accessories for damage.
Rack or cabinet hardware installation
You may either place the switch on the rack shelf or mount the switch directly into a 19" wide, EIA-310- E-compliant rack—
four-post, two-post, or threaded methods. The ReadyRails™ system is provided for one 1U front-rack and two-post installations.
The ReadyRails system includes two separately packaged rail assemblies and two rails that are shipped attached to the sides of
the switch.
